HOUSE RESOLUTION

 
2    WHEREAS, The members of the Illinois House of
3Representatives are saddened to learn of the death of Andrew
4James "Andy" Werhane of Poplar Grove, who passed away on April
526, 2025; and
 
6    WHEREAS, Andy Werhane was born to Mary and James Werhane
7on October 26, 1982 and raised in Lena; he graduated from
8Lena-Winslow High School in 2001, where he played both
9football and baseball; he graduated from Eastern Illinois
10University in 2007 with a Bachelor of Arts in English and a
11high school teaching certificate; he earned a Master of Arts
12in Educational Technology from Concordia University in 2016
13and a Master of Arts in Educational Leadership from Aurora
14University in 2023; while going through school, he also worked
15in his family's trucking business, Werhane Enterprises,
16washing and maintaining trucks; he married Sarah Werhane on
17November 12, 2011; and
 
18    WHEREAS, Andy Werhane was passionate about being an
19educator and made a lasting impact on the community of
20Belvidere during his time at Belvidere High School, where he
21taught English for nine years, and later as assistant
22principal of Washington Academy; he coached baseball, bowling,
23and golf and inspired countless students with his guidance and

1compassion; he was also a technology coach for nine years; and
 
2    WHEREAS, Andy Werhane was a loyal fan of the Chicago Cubs
3and Bears; he enjoyed music and golf and was a lifelong seeker
4of knowledge; and
 
5    WHEREAS, Andy Werhane was a devoted and caring husband,
6father, friend, and teacher; he was known for his humility and
7kindness; and
 
8    WHEREAS, Andy Werhane was preceded in death by little Baby
9A and his nephew, Patrick Michael Heagney; and
 
10    WHEREAS, Andy Werhane is survived by his wife, Sarah; his
11children, Olivia Katherine Werhane and James Arthur Werhane;
12his parents; his mother and father-in-law, Timothy and Suzanne
13Heagney; his siblings, Nicholas James (Katherine) Werhane,
14Joseph James (Genevieve) Werhane, and Ryan James (Heidi)
15Werhane; his brothers-in-law, Timothy (Samantha) Heagney Jr.
16and Thomas Heagney; his nieces and nephews, Lillian, Ellaina,
17Noah, Brinley, Allie, Charlotte, and Layton Werhane; his
18grandparents, Fred and Betty Werhane and Ronald and Patricia
19Mahon; and numerous aunts, uncles, cousins, friends, students,
20and colleagues; therefore, be it
 
21    RESOLVED, BY THE HOUSE OF REPRESENTATIVES OF THE ONE

1HUNDRED FOURTH GENERAL ASSEMBLY OF THE STATE OF ILLINOIS, that
2we mourn the passing of Andrew James "Andy" Werhane and extend
3our sincere condolences to his family, friends, and all who
4knew and loved him; and be it further
 
5    RESOLVED, That a suitable copy of this resolution be
6presented to the family of Andy Werhane as an expression of our
7deepest sympathy.
